Over 23 miles of multi-use trails meander through beautiful woodlands, hugging the shoreline of Norris Lake and ascending to the ridge top where there are great views of the river below, the Cumberland Mountains and the Smokies; 2.5 miles of foot-traffic-only trail winds through the Hemlock Bluffs Small Wild Area; water access for swimming, fishing, and paddling; camping is available at the Loyston Point Campground.
